cuttsie Posted September 25, 2023 Author Share Posted September 25, 2023 1 hour ago, carosio said: Where does the money go? NASA's budget request for fiscal year 2022 reflects a topical range of priorities. The four highlighted priorities are: Addressing the climate crisis nationally and internationally.This includes a next-generation Earth system observatory, sustainable flight partnerships, and university research. Restoring America's global standing.The Artemis missions to the Moon, the International Space Station, and international partnerships all fall under this category. Promoting racial and economic equality by increasing the participation of historically underserved communities in STEM. This also includes landing the first woman and person of color on the Moon through the Artemis missions. Driving economic growth by leading American dominance in emerging markets and space technology. There's also more than $280 million allotted for investments in small business innovation research.
